Beverley 10k 2011 – Information for Spectators

The race starts at 11.15 next to the Minster in Eastgate and finishes in .  The fastest runners will complete the course in about 30 minutes while the slowest are expected to take no longer than 80 minutes.

There are a number of vantage points for spectators in the town centre:

•    Start – Eastgate and
•    Finish – Toll Gavel and Butcher row

Those preferring to be out on the course could watch runners at the 1-mile point on Newbald Road and then walk across the to Road to see them at 5½ miles.

After the race, family and friends are advised to meet up with runners at the centre to minimise congestion in the finish area in where all 1200 competitors will finish within about 50 minutes of each other.

Fun Run
The popular B&A Scaffolding 2k fun run precedes the 10k at 10.30.  It starts and finishes on field at the centre.  Runners will be supported by Bertie and Roary the Tiger.  It is also hoped that KR’s Rufus Robin and ’s Airlie Bird will join them.
